John Keyho
(c 1857-)
Father | Peter Keyho (c 1829-before 1881) |
Mother | Judith Ozanne (c 1828-) |
John Keyho, son of Peter Keyho and Judith Ozanne, was born in St Peter Port, GuernseyG, in about 1857.1 He married in about 1882, Elizabeth Roberge De Garis.
In 1861 John was living at 12 Distillery Road, St Peter Port, GuernseyG, in the household of his parents Peter and Judith, and was recorded in the census as John Keyho, aged three and born in St Peter Port.2
In 1881 he was living at 44 Grand Bouet Road, St Peter PortG, in the household of his widowed mother Judith, and was recorded as John Keyho, a draper's assistant, unmarried, aged 23 and born in St Sampson's, Guernsey.3
In 1891 John was living at Wesleyville, Bouet, St Peter Port, GuernseyG, and was recorded in the census as John Keyho, a draper's assistant, head of household, married, aged 33 and born in Guernsey. Living with him were his wife Elizabeth, 35, and their children, Thomas, 8, Winifred, 7, William, 5, George, 2, and Walter, aged one.4
In 1901 John was living at Grand Bouet Road, St Peter PortG, and was recorded in the census as John Keyho, a draper, an employer, head of household, married, aged 43 and born in St Peter Port. Living with him were his wife Elizabeth, 45, and their children, Thomas, 18, Winifred, 17, William, 15, George, 12, Walter, 11, Laura, 9, Ada, 8, Lilian, 6, Clarisse, 5, and Eunice, aged one.5
